While the program is <a href=\"https:\/\/www.dni.gov\/files\/CLPT\/documents\/2024_ASTR_for_CY2023.pdf\">targeted at&nbsp; foreign sources<\/a>, it also sweeps up millions of phone records and metadata of<a href=\"https:\/\/documents.pclob.gov\/prod\/Documents\/OversightReport\/d21d1c6b-6de3-4bc4-b018-6c9151a0497d\/2023%20PCLOB%20702%20Report,%20508%20Completed,%20Dec%203,%202024.pdf\"> American citizens and U.S. persons<\/a> that can later be searched by agencies like the FBI in domestic investigations.<\/p>\n<p>Gabbard had previously described Section 702 as \u201coverreach,\u201d and as a member of the House introduced <a href=\"https:\/\/x.com\/TulsiGabbard\/status\/1339249493921984520?ref_src=twsrc%5Etfw\">legislation<\/a> to repeal the program. Since being nominated, Gabbard has <a href=\"https:\/\/www.nbcnews.com\/politics\/national-security\/gabbards-surveillance-flip-will-spotlight-dni-hearing-rcna189643\">made statements<\/a> characterizing the program as a \u201cvital national security tool.\u201d&nbsp;&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p>Warner described that change of heart as \u201cwelcome\u201d but \u201cnot credible\u201d given the timing.<\/p>\n<p>Gabbard said that Congress and the Foreign Intelligence Surveillance Court, rather than ODNI, should decide whether warrants are required for accessing data on U.S. persons. She remained noncommittal on whether she supported provisions in an <a href=\"https:\/\/www.washingtonpost.com\/national-security\/2024\/04\/20\/congress-extends-controversial-warrantless-surveillance-law-two-years\/\">extension<\/a> of Section 702 that required device owners to cooperate with data requests from the government.<\/p>\n<p>Warner also castigated Gabbard for praising former NSA contractor Edward Snowden as a \u201cbrave whistleblower\u201d deserving of a pardon, and claiming in pre-hearing interviews that the director of national intelligence did not have a role in determining whether Snowden was a \u201clawful whistleblower.\u201d Snowden\u2019s 2013 leak exposed numerous global surveillance programs being run by the NSA, the U.S. government and by allies in the Five Eyes Alliance.<\/p>\n<div class=\"ad ad--inline_1 \">\n<div class=\"ad__inner\"> <span class=\"screen-reader-text\">Advertisement<\/span> <\/div>\n<\/div>\n<p>Those revelations led to significant legal and bureaucratic reforms around the way intelligence and law enforcement agencies can collect and use call information and metadata of U.S. persons, but Warner described Snowden as \u201csomeone who betrayed the trust and jeopardized the security of our nation.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What message would it send to the intelligence workforce to have a DNI who would celebrate staff and contractors deciding to leak our nation\u2019s most sensitive secrets as they see fit?\u201d Warner said.<\/p>\n<p>But during questioning from Warner, Gabbard again backtracked, saying flatly that Snowden \u201cbroke the law\u201d and that he should have gone through official government channels to report wrongdoing.<\/p>\n<p>She continued to defend her criticism of U.S. surveillance programs and noted that Snowden\u2019s disclosures led to government reform, calling them \u201creflective of the egregious and illegal programs that were exposed in that leak.\u201d She also declined to answer if she believed Snowden was a \u201ctraitor.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I take very seriously the protection of American civil liberties and our Fourth Amendment rights,\u201d Gabbard told Sen. Angus King, I-Maine. \u201cIf confirmed as director of national intelligence, I\u2019d make sure there\u2019s no further Snowden-type leak in the future and that those who have concerns have legal channels to raise those concerns so that we don\u2019t violate and release our nation\u2019s secrets.\u201d<\/p>\n<div class=\"ad ad--inline_1 \">\n<div class=\"ad__inner\"> <span class=\"screen-reader-text\">Advertisement<\/span> <\/div>\n<\/div>\n<p>Snowden, for his part, commented on social media that he believes Gabbard would not be able to answer questions about him truthfully and maintain support for her nomination in Congress.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cTulsi Gabbard will be required to disown all prior support for whistleblowers as a condition of confirmation [Thursday]. I encourage her to do so,\u201d Snowden <a href=\"https:\/\/x.com\/Snowden\/status\/1884935491423777093\">wrote<\/a> on X. \u201cTell them I harmed national security and the sweet, soft feelings of staff.
